132nd Square Park

BUT DON'T PUT AWAY THOSE WORK GLOVES JUST YET!
The community build of the playground is just the first of three Phases of improvement planned for 132nd Square Park. The North County Parks Coalition will be applying for $100,000 in community grant funds from King County for additional improvements to the park and YOUR INPUT IS WANTED! There will be a Kick-Off for Phase 2 the first week of September. In the meantime we want to begin gathering input and areas of interest and expertise for the following items that will be pursued in Phase 2:
1) Swings
2) Natural Amphitheatre
3) Exercise Stations (along paths)
4) Basketball court
5) Landscaping
